About Tiralis

Tiralis builds AI-powered compliance software for regulated industries, with an initial focus on life sciences.

Companies in these industries operate through controlled procedures, standards and records. Understanding how those sources relate, what changed and where a gap may exist still takes a great deal of manual work.

Tiralis uses language models, structured data and knowledge graphs to turn those sources into traceable information. We connect procedures, requirements, evidence and operating knowledge so that quality teams can use them in their daily work, with a clear path back to the source.

The work combines document processing, context engineering, model training and evaluation, structured extraction, human review and the product workflows that bring those parts together.

Tiralis is not a multi-tenant SaaS play. Each client receives a separate tenant deployment. The platform must work in the cloud, on premises and, where required, inside isolated environments, based on the client compliance requirements, and preferences.

The platform The platform is being built around:

- React and TypeScript
- Go services backed by PostgreSQL and Redis.
- REST, gRPC and WebSocket interfaces.
- AI and LLM pipelines for processing documents and producing structured compliance data.
- Context-engineering, model-training and evaluation workflows developed with the ML team.
- Knowledge-graph capabilities that connect source material, extracted knowledge and external requirements.
- Container-based deployment, with AWS as the current development environment.
- Terraform-managed AWS infrastructure.

We are designing the core data and knowledge layer to remain stable and reusable while application and UI modules develop around product and client needs. Over time, we expect to separate current operational state from historical data. Lakehouse and versioned-data patterns will help us preserve past versions of records and knowledge graphs for auditability and time-based views. Apache Iceberg is one option on that roadmap.

How we hire The process begins with an introductory call, followed by a practical exercise based on a real Tiralis problem. The exercise is scoped to four or five focused hours. If you reach five hours, stop and tell us where you stopped. We will then spend about two hours reviewing your work, the choices you made and the options you rejected. This discussion carries more weight than polish.

AI coding tools are allowed and expected. Tell us what you used and how it affected your work.

One-to-one conversations with founders may follow the technical review. The process concludes with an HR discussion covering fit and practical terms.
